On , OSHA opened a complaint safety inspection of DELAWARE VALLEY REMEDIATION, LLC in 1401 NORTH 5TH STREET, PHILADELPHIA, PA 19122 (NAICS 562910). OSHA activity number 341595775.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.502(d)(15): Anchorage points used for attachment of personal fall arrest equipment were not independent of any anchorage point being used to support or suspend platforms and capable of supporting at least 5,000 pounds (22.2 kN) per employee a) Jobsite - The employer did not ensure that each employee using a personal fall arrest system was attached to anchorage capable of supporting five thousand (5,000) pounds. Observed on or about 01 JULY 2016.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.503(a)(1): The employer did not provide a training program for each employee potentially exposed to fall hazards to enable each employee to recognize the hazards of falling and the procedures to be followed in order to minimize these hazards: a) Jobsite - The employer did not provide the employees engaged in construction activities with the training to enable them to identify, recognize, and mitigate fall hazards. Noted on or about 01 JULY 2016.
